Java Backend Engineer
Location:
Guadalajara, Mexico
Seniority:
Middle
Technologies:
Java

We’re looking for a Back-End Engineer to join a large-scale digital transformation initiative with a global retail leader. This role is ideal for engineers who bring strong backend and systems integration experience and are excited to work on cloud-native, scalable architectures. You will be part of a multidisciplinary team delivering core capabilities for mission-critical, customer-facing applications, with a focus on backend services, data workflows, and system performance.

  • Design and implement RESTful and GraphQL services using Java and Spring Boot

  • Contribute to scalable system architecture and component integration strategies

  • Work closely with DevOps teams to ensure reliable deployments and monitoring across cloud-native environments

  • Support workflow orchestration using tools like Apache Airflow

  • Collaborate with frontend and data teams to ensure cohesive system behavior

  • Engage in production support and participate in incident resolution during office hours

  • Follow clean code principles and contribute to shared engineering standards

  • Participate in agile ceremonies, code reviews, and collaborative planning sessions

  • Proficient in Java and Spring Boot for backend service development

  • Experience with cloud-native infrastructure (AWS, Kubernetes)

  • Familiarity with distributed systems tooling (Kafka, observability tools)

  • Strong grasp of relational and NoSQL databases (e.g., MySQL, PostgreSQL)

  • Familiarity with Apache Airflow and DAG-based processing

  • Solid understanding of system design, integration patterns, and performance tuning

  • Excellent analytical, problem-solving, and communication skills

  • Bonus: Familiarity with React and frontend ecosystems

Discover what it’s like to work with us
Join Our Team!
Attaching my CV:
Your message is sent. Thank you for contacting us, we will get in touch with you soon.